Hi my name is Jim and I finally have a corvette!!!! I was fortunate that I was able to buy it from my brother this past June and now is now looking for a 2003. I don't know if there is a greater feeling being able to drive down the street in a vette. It is in good shape but it has a few problems but that is okay because I have time to take care of it and then make it the way I want. I want to replace the center counsel and find an original radio, does anyone have any idea's of a good place to get parts like that? I would also like to take my original rims and have them chromed I want to keep it mostly original with some changes. This is all new to me and I am looking forward to learning alot on this forum.

when i got my 92 my console cover was chipped up so instead of paying 135.00 i figured what have i got to lose, so i took it off used old brake fluid to strip the coating on it , primed it and gave a couple coats of black satin spray. looks great, just buy some striper at store and use that
